Important results from the project
Opportunities for research and innovation collaboration would be explored with the Brazilian research institute SENAI and companies in the restaurant and mining industry in Brazil. In addition, local conditions would be investigated for potential of further development and establishment of new Swedish technology, in bioprocesses and metal extraction. Focus areas have been bioeconomy and circular economy. The above was done during the year with a positive response and good interest in collaborations. Unfortunately, Covid-19 and change of project management created delays.
Expected long term effects
We have held digital meetings with: - Marcelo Moutini, Director R&D Technology Dept at Hydro / Alu Norte - Paulo Pietrobon at RECICLI (Electrical Waste Recycling) who also leads a Mining Hub project for CBPM (Mineral Research Bahia Company) - Flavio Ortigao, Recupera, which produces hydrogen from plastic Contact was sought with Ocean CleanUp for a possibility to use plastic waste from the Para river for the production of hydrogen and during the visit to Belém we would visit the palm oil industry, Heiniken factory and the city´s waste unit to find out the availability of biowaste.
Approach and implementation
The structured plan, based on a visit in Brazil, was difficult to uphold merely by digital contact, despite good efforts. Especially as most of the stakeholders had to adapt to the pandemic and change their priorities. Of obvious reasons the collection of material for techno economic and market potential analysis was impossible to manage.
